Abstract

Dental caries is a chronic disease with multifactorial etiology, with variable pathogenesis and is the most prevalent unmet health care need in children. The aim of the study is to evaluate the age and gender wise prevalence of dental caries among children. A retrospective study was carried out among children reported to a private Dental University from June 2019-March 2020. Patient records were collected and evaluated independently by calibrated examiners. Patients in the age group of 6-16 years were selected for the study. A total of 217 patients met the inclusion criteria and were eligible for the study.The mean DMFT/dmft score was found to be 3.78. Chi square analysis showed no statistically significant result between gender and DMFT/dmft score, since p value >0.05. Males were more affected than females. It can be concluded that caries prevalence and mean DMFT/dmft was found to be higher in males and in the age group of 6-8 years specifically.
